The Guaranty Bond Claim Refine



Now let's study the surety bond claim process, where you'll find out how to browse with it smoothly.

When a claim is made on a surety bond, it implies that the principal, the party responsible for meeting the obligations, has actually stopped working to satisfy their dedications.

As the claimant, your very first step is to inform the surety business in blogging about the breach of contract. Supply all the essential paperwork, consisting of the bond number, contract information, and evidence of the default.

The surety company will then investigate the claim to determine its legitimacy. If the case is accepted, the surety will step in to meet the commitments or make up the complaintant as much as the bond amount.

It is necessary to follow the insurance claim procedure carefully and supply exact info to make sure a successful resolution.

Financial Implications of Surety Bond Claims



When facing guaranty bond claims, you need to know the financial ramifications that may emerge. Guaranty bond cases can have considerable financial effects for all parties entailed.

If a claim is made versus a bond, the guaranty business may be called for to make up the obligee for any type of losses incurred due to the principal's failure to fulfill their responsibilities. This payment can include the settlement of damages, lawful charges, and various other costs associated with the case.

Furthermore, if the guaranty business is called for to pay out on a claim, they may look for reimbursement from the principal. This can result in the principal being financially in charge of the total of the claim, which can have a detrimental influence on their organization and financial stability.

For that reason, it's essential for principals to meet their responsibilities to prevent prospective economic repercussions.
